class IntegerType(JSONTypeHelper):
class _NumericType(JSONTypeHelper[T]):
"""Abstract numeric type for integers and numbers."""

__type_name__: str

def __init__(
self,
*,
minimum: int | None = None,
maximum: int | None = None,
exclusive_minimum: int | None = None,
exclusive_maximum: int | None = None,
multiple_of: int | None = None,
**kwargs: t.Any,
) -> None:
"""Initialize IntegerType.
Args:
minimum: Minimum numeric value. See the
:jsonschema:`JSON Schema reference <numeric#range>` for details.
maximum: Maximum numeric value.
:jsonschema:`JSON Schema reference <numeric#range>` for details.
exclusive_minimum: Exclusive minimum numeric value.
:jsonschema:`JSON Schema reference <numeric#range>` for details.
exclusive_maximum: Exclusive maximum numeric value. See the
:jsonschema:`JSON Schema reference <numeric#range>` for details.
multiple_of: A number that the value must be a multiple of. See the
:jsonschema:`JSON Schema reference <numeric#multiples>` for details.
**kwargs: Additional keyword arguments to pass to the parent class.
"""
super().__init__(**kwargs)
self.minimum = minimum
self.maximum = maximum
self.exclusive_minimum = exclusive_minimum
self.exclusive_maximum = exclusive_maximum
self.multiple_of = multiple_of

@DefaultInstanceProperty
def type_dict(self) -> dict:
"""Get type dictionary.
Returns:
A dictionary describing the type.
"""
result = {"type": [self.__type_name__], **self.extras}

if self.minimum is not None:
result["minimum"] = self.minimum

if self.maximum is not None:
result["maximum"] = self.maximum

if self.exclusive_minimum is not None:
result["exclusiveMinimum"] = self.exclusive_minimum

if self.exclusive_maximum is not None:
result["exclusiveMaximum"] = self.exclusive_maximum

if self.multiple_of is not None:
result["multipleOf"] = self.multiple_of

return result
